Sentrycs’ proprietary Protocol Manipulation (Cyber-Over-RF) technology identifies, tracks, and takes control of unauthorized drones with high precision-without jamming, spoofing, or disrupting surrounding communications networks. Its solutions are deployed across defense, public safety, aviation, and critical infrastructure markets, enabling safe mitigation even in dense, highly regulated environments. Sentrycs has approximately 200 global deployments to date across six continents in more than 25 countries.
The integration of Sentrycs technology into OAS’ System-of-Systems platform creates a unified CUAS architecture combining cyber takeover, autonomous interception with Iron Drone Raider, real-time sensor fusion, and AI-driven decision-making. This enhanced product suite positions Ondas to address the accelerating global demand for layered CUAS infrastructure, particularly in urban population centers, airports, borders, and strategic national facilities, where safe, low-collateral solutions are required.
